MEMO — Branch Managers

Subject: Launch Plan — VentaCore 3

Launch date confirmed for early next quarter. Demo units ship to all branches two weeks prior. Training webinars run the preceding Thursday and Friday; attendance mandatory. Hold all pricing discussions until the rate card arrives. Marketing collateral follows separately. Do not circulate this memo beyond your teams, as it precedes a sensitive strategic update.

board note of kafog-bajep: Briathek Partners is in early talks to buy Aldaelek Group for about $47.1 million. The Ulaath launch date is September 4, and nothing goes to the press before then.

## 3.2.0 — Barcode Scanner Integration

Tillwright now ships a native bridge for the Corvid-9 barcode scanner family. Plugin authors should migrate from the polling API to the new `onScanEvent` callback, which delivers decoded payloads with symbology metadata. The legacy endpoint remains available but is deprecated and will be removed in 4.0. Compatibility questions and bridge bug reports should be directed to the integration maintainer listed below.

account owner for bawip-tahag: Raleth Quenok

Finance Review Summary — Tollam Franchise Agreement

The franchise agreement with Tollam Provisions was reviewed this quarter. Royalty rates remain at 6% of net sales, with the marketing levy unchanged. Two branches in the Carroway district underperformed minimum thresholds and will receive support plans rather than penalties this cycle. Branch managers should budget accordingly for the coming half-year. The strategic context for renewing on these terms appears in the note below.

confidential, kagap-yagef: The finance team signed off on a budget of $467.8 million for Project Aldok.